Contact the farm for details Purchase a share of our farm’s harvest in the spring and get a basket of fresh produce direct from our farm every week during the harvest season. This helps us by covering some of our start-up costs like seed, fertilizer, and labor. You will also be supporting local agriculture and helping to preserve open space in Rhode Island. In these days of concern about food safety and the use of fossil fuels in food transport, you will have the peace of mind of knowing where your food is grown and who grew it. If you have children, they will be more connected to their food and realize that a tomato doesn’t come from the grocery store; it comes from a farm. Share options: Full Share (feeds 3 to 6 people) • Between 10 and 30 pounds of produce a week for 19 weeks Single Share (feeds 1 to 3 people) • Between 6 and 20 pounds of produce a week for 19 weeks A sample of what produce to expect In June, a single share may get in a week: • bag of lettuce or spring mix • 1 pound zucchini and yellow squash • ¾ pound sweet peas • 1 bunch baby turnips or beets • 1 bunch radishes • ½ pound green onions • 1 bunch broccoli • 1 head cabbage or kale In September, a single share may get in a week: • ½ dozen sweet corn • 1 ½ pounds tomatoes • 1 or 2 cucumbers • 2-3 red or green peppers • 1 pint cherry or grape tomatoes • 1-2 eggplant • 1 native muskmelon or cantelope • in-season fruit (e.g., pears, peaches) Pick-Up You will be expected to pick up your produce at our farm stand at 364 Boyds Lane, Portsmouth, RI (just off Rte. 24), on Thursdays or Fridays between 4 and 6:45 p.m. You must choose one pick-up day for the whole season.

What is CSA?
Community Supported Agriculture, often shortened to CSA, is a prepaid subscription to a farm's produce for the season. Most CSAs give shareholders a weekly supply of veggies, herbs, fruits and sometimes even eggs and meat. You know it's fresh and you get to meet the farm and people who grew your food! The prepaid CSA arrangements also makes it a source of financial security for the farmer. Some CSAs also incorporate farm workdays for shareholders. Pickup days vary by farm and some offer pickups in Providence.

CSAs have been very popular recently. Be sure to sign up early before subscriptions are filled!
